How much does it cost to rent a home in D Lo?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| D Lo 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,216 | $950 | $1,700 |
D Lo 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,419 | $900 | $2,387 |
| D Lo 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,398 | $1,300 | $1,575 |
| D Lo 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,600 | $1,600 | $1,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about D Lo
What type of rentals are currently available in D Lo?
There are currently 43 Apartments for Rent in D Lo, MS with pricing that ranges from $705 to $3,505. There are also 42 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in D Lo ranging from $250 to $2,387.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in D Lo?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in D Lo ranges from $250 to $2,387 with an average monthly rent of $1,085.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in D Lo?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in D Lo range from $848 to $3,505,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$900 to $2,387.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,300 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,475.
